obligations and responsibilities:

Kitchen Aides essentially offer assistance with an assortment of assignments, depending on what the Cooks or Waitstaff required at the time. A few of their fundamental obligations and duties include:

  • Cleaning and mopping the kitchen
  • removing the trash and replacing it with trash bags
  • Cleaning, drying, and discarding all kitchenware and dishes
  • Unloading food supplies from delivery trucks
  • Assisting chefs with meal preparation by cleaning, chopping, peeling, and chopping items
  • assembling customer takeaway orders
  • When required, clearing and cleaning tables for waitstaff
  • Restocking tables with condiments or other materials

  1. What is the duty of a kitchen assistant?

    The Kitchen Assistant assists in food preparation. He/She ensures that utensils and work areas are clean and ready for the next shift. He/She also ensures that all kitchen equipment and structures are kept and maintained in safe and good working order at all times. He/She assists in stock take and storage of stock.

  3. How much do kitchen helpers make in Poland?

    The average pay for a Kitchen Assistant is PLN 52,016 a year and PLN 25 an hour in Poland. The average salary range for a Kitchen Assistant is between PLN 40,572 and PLN 59,350. On average, a High School Degree is the highest level of education for a Kitchen Assistant.
